Taro Logo

Software Engineer III, Full Stack, Infrastructure, YouTube

A global technology company that develops internet-related services and products, including search, cloud computing, software, and online advertising technologies.
Mid-Level Software Engineer
In-Person
5,000+ Employees
2+ years of experience
Enterprise SaaS

Description For Software Engineer III, Full Stack, Infrastructure, YouTube

Google's YouTube division is seeking a Full Stack Software Engineer III to join their Infrastructure team. This role combines backend and frontend development to build scalable solutions that power YouTube's platform used by billions of users worldwide. At YouTube, the mission is to give everyone a voice and show them the world, working at the intersection of cutting-edge technology and creativity.

The position requires strong technical expertise in full-stack development, with experience in languages like Java, Python, Golang, or C++ for backend, and JavaScript/TypeScript for frontend work. You'll be responsible for developing critical systems, participating in technical design reviews, and ensuring code quality through peer reviews.

This is an excellent opportunity for experienced developers who want to impact billions of users while working with cutting-edge technology. You'll be part of a team that values innovation, collaboration, and technical excellence, working on projects that shape how people connect and share content globally.

The role offers the chance to work with Google's world-class engineering teams, tackle complex technical challenges at scale, and contribute to YouTube's mission of showing people the world through shared stories and experiences. You'll be involved in the full development lifecycle, from design to deployment, while working with modern technologies and best practices in software engineering.

Last updated 2 days ago

Responsibilities For Software Engineer III, Full Stack, Infrastructure, YouTube

  • Write product or system development code
  • Participate in, or lead design reviews with peers and stakeholders to decide amongst available technologies
  • Review code developed by other developers and provide feedback to ensure best practices
  • Contribute to existing documentation or educational content and adapt content based on product/program updates and user feedback
  • Triage product or system issues and debug/track/resolve by analyzing the sources of issues and the impact on hardware, network, or service operations and quality

Requirements For Software Engineer III, Full Stack, Infrastructure, YouTube

Java
Python
Go
JavaScript
TypeScript
  • Bachelor's degree or equivalent practical experience
  • 2 years of experience with software development in one or more programming languages, or 1 year of experience with an advanced degree
  • 2 years of experience with data structures or algorithms
  • 2 years of experience with full stack development, across back-end such as Java, Python, Golang, or C++ codebases, and front-end experience including JavaScript or TypeScript, HTML, CSS or equivalent

Interested in this job?

Jobs Related To Google Software Engineer III, Full Stack, Infrastructure, YouTube

Software Engineering, Full Stack

Full Stack Software Engineering position at Google's Core team in Hyderabad, building foundational technologies that power Google's flagship products.

Software Engineer II, Full Stack, Google Ads

Full Stack Software Engineer II position at Google Ads, focusing on developing and maintaining advertising technology solutions using both front-end and back-end technologies.

Software Engineer III, Full Stack, Google Cloud

Full Stack Software Engineer III position at Google Cloud in Warsaw, focusing on developing enterprise-grade solutions using both front-end and back-end technologies.

Software Engineer III, Full Stack, Google Cloud

Full Stack Software Engineer III position at Google Cloud, developing enterprise-grade solutions and next-generation technologies that impact billions of users worldwide.

Software Engineer III, Full Stack, Google Cloud Platforms

Full-stack Software Engineer III position at Google Cloud, focusing on developing and maintaining large-scale systems with both frontend and backend technologies.